Costs are driven by the city's extreme wind-driven precipitation and salt air, which require premium materials like ice-and-water shields and wind-resistant architectural shingles. Additionally, disposal fees on the Avalon Peninsula are roughly 15-20% higher than in rural NL due to limited landfill capacity.
Due to high wind speeds, most local contractors and insurance providers require 'storm-nailing,' which uses 5-6 nails per shingle instead of the standard 3-4. This adds approximately $500 to $1,200 in labor and fastener costs for an average 2,000 sq ft roof.
The City of St. John's charges permit fees based on construction value. For a typical $16,900 roof replacement, the permit fee is approximately $152 (calculated at $9 per $1,000 of value), though total administrative and inspection costs often range from $400 to $800 for complex projects.
The peak season is June to September. Due to the brief construction window, contractors often book 4-6 months in advance. Booking in the late fall for a spring start can sometimes secure a 5% 'off-season' discount on labor rates.
